Title: | Investigation of the Process of Methane-Oxygen Combustion in Steam Under the Atmospheric Pressure |

Abstract: | In the article presented results of combustion methane-oxygen mixtures in the slightly superheated water steam under the atmospheric pressure. It is shown that exist dependence of flow rate combustible mixture and steam ratio (G[g.s]./G[s]) on the composition of the reacting mixture at the outlet of combustion chamber. There is a trend of increasing CO2 concentration in the reacting mixture at the outlet of combustion chamber with increase of G[g.s]./G[s]. |
